Can a Scissor Lift Be Controlled by Electricity or Gas?

A vibrant blue electric scissor lift and a rugged yellow diesel lift on a construction site

Have you ever wondered about picking an electric or gas scissor lift? Let’s explore this together!

Scissor lifts use either electricity or gas (diesel) for operation. Electric lifts work best indoors. They are quiet and produce no harmful emissions. Diesel lifts fit outdoor tasks perfectly. They have more power and lift heavier loads.

Why Opt for Diesel Scissor Lifts in Outdoor Projects?

I remember when I first needed to pick a lift for an outdoor job. I felt really stressed. Diesel scissor lifts completely changed everything. Here’s why!

Diesel scissor lifts suit outdoor projects because of their strong lifting power. These machines show great durability. They handle rough ground easily. Diesel models perform better than electric ones in tough situations. Power stays consistent, with no battery limits to worry about.

Diesel scissor lift on a construction site
Diesel Scissor Lift

Strong Lifting Power

I remember a job where materials felt incredibly heavy. Diesel scissor lifts truly impressed me. They lift heavy weights2 and reach high places. This strength helps a lot when handling big construction items daily.

Feature Diesel Lifts Electric Lifts
Maximum Height Up to 60 feet Up to 40 feet
Weight Capacity Up to 1,500 kg Up to 800 kg

Performance on Rough Ground

Driving equipment over a bumpy site can be tough. Diesel scissor lifts make it simple. Their strong tires3 and solid frames keep them steady on uneven surfaces. Rough ground becomes another task.

How Do Operating Costs Compare Between Electric and Diesel Lifts?

Consider which lift – electric or diesel – saves more money over time. Compare their operating costs to find out which one suits you best.

Electric lifts usually have lower running costs because they need little fuel and few repairs. Diesel lifts usually cost more because they use more fuel and need more repairs. Before deciding, think about what the job needs and where it is.

Cost Comparison Table

Here’s a simplified comparison of the key cost factors:

Cost Factor Electric Lifts Diesel Lifts
Fuel Costs None High (diesel fuel)
Maintenance Frequency Low Moderate to High
Battery/Engine Costs Battery replacement (occasional) Engine servicing (regular)
Environmental Impact Low (no emissions) High (fumes and noise)
